epicolic
\\|epə̇, |epē+\ adjective
Etymology: International Scientific Vocabulary epi- + colic (of the colon)
: situated upon or over the colon — used especially of the region of the abdomen adjacent to the colon

epicolic, a. Anat.
(ɛpɪˈkɒlɪk)
[f. epi- + Gr. κόλον colon. Cf. F. épicolique.]
Of or pertaining to the region of the body which is over, or in the course of, the colon.
